AAP MPs Quit: Arvind Kejriwal-led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) will turn 14 on November 26 this year. When it stemmed from the anti-corruption movement around 14 years ago, prominent AAP founders, including Arvind Kejriwal, Manish Sisodia, Prashant Bhushan, Yogendra Yadav, Kumar Biswas, Shanti Bhushan, and a number of young professionals, created a huge hype, promising an alternative and positive politics.
However, in the last 14 years, several prominent leaders, including founders, deserted the party, alleging it does not allign to its ideologies.
7 AAP MPs, Raghav Chadha, Sandeep Pathak, Ashok Mittal, Harbhajan Singh, Rajinder Gupta, Vikram Sahney and Swati Maliwal's departure reminded AAP's long history of losing prominent leaders.
Why Did Top AAP Founders Leave The Party In Early Days?
The story of Exodus started months after the party floated. Yogendra Yadav and Prashant Bhushan, two strong pillars of the party, were expelled in 2015 for alleged anti-party activities. The duo questioned the internal democracy and alleged autocracy of Kejriwal.
Shazia Ilmi ( quit in 2014), senior journalist Ashutosh (2018), popular poet Kumar Vishwas (2018), and Kailash Gahlot (2024), several close aides of Kejriwal left him. The list of leaders is long. Kejriwal's team of 2012 was totally different from that of today.

Why Did One After Another Leutenants Of Kejriwal Break Up With Him?
AAP, under Kejriwal's leadership, faced several allegations, including a lack of decentralisation. Several AAP rebels alleged that Kejriwal's way of functioning is autocratic. He is the national convenor, the top post in AAP since the commencement of the party. Prashant Bhushan alleged in 2015 that the AAP was running like a Khaap (panchayat), tearing into party leader Kejriwal.

Yogendra Yadav alleged that Kejriwal sold out the soul of the anti-corruption movement for joining hands with JD-U’s Nitish Kumar and RJD chief Lalu Prasad in Bihar in 2016.

Gahlot, who joined the BJP ahead of the Delhi elections in 2024, alleged that his party had not fulfilled poll promises in Delhi. He also slammed Kejriwal over the "Sheeshmahal" row, the controversy around the Chief Minister's residence renovated during AAP rule in Delhi.

Swati Maliwal, who was reportedly assaulted by Bibhav Kumar, a close aide to Kejriwal, at the CM's residence in May 2024, alleged that Kejriwal has protected the accused, abandoning the party's core values.

AAP's public image was also damaged due to the alleged liquor scam case, due to which Kejriwal, Sisodia, Sanjay Singh and other party leaders were jailed and are now out on bail. The AAP faces a serious allegation of corruption by the BJP and its ally, Congress. The saffron party questioned whether it is the same party that emerged from the anti-corruption movement.
